## Ownership

Incremental rebuilds for the Hollowpine static site are handled by the `rebuild-delta` service. It tracks content hashes per page and only regenerates affected routes, which keeps deploys under a minute. New team members should read `docs/rebuild-flow` before touching the dependency graph logic, since a wrong edge can force full rebuilds for everyone. Changes to invalidation rules require review, and the component is maintained by the engineer named below.

account owner for bawip-tahag: Raleth Quenok

## Build Provenance: ShrinkRay CLI

Hey plugin folks! Every ShrinkRay release (our batch image resizer) ships with a provenance record so you can verify the binary you're building against. We build on Pemberly Labs' hosted runners, and each artifact gets signed before it hits the download mirror. If your plugin behaves oddly, first confirm you're on an official build — unofficial forks float around. To verify, compare your binary's embedded token against the one published below.

build token for kagaf-hahof: htk14_9d3d4d26d7d8de

# Velcrest Exporter — Environments

Failed exports retry automatically in staging and prod; dev requires manual re-trigger. Retries use exponential backoff, capped at six attempts. Dead-lettered jobs land in the audit bucket and are never re-run without review. All environments share identical retry logic; only limits differ. The production retry settings currently in effect are as follows:

deployment values, yafop-tahof:
HOLIX_HOST=holix.zemvarsys.internal
HOLIX_PORT=3306

Bulk edits in the Quillbarn admin table are applied through a queued batch worker, not directly against the primary database. Before deploying, confirm the worker pool is drained; an in-flight batch that spans a schema change can leave rows half-updated with no automatic rollback. On-call engineers should also verify that the batch size cap matches staging, since oversized batches have previously locked the accounts table for minutes. Once the worker is confirmed idle, apply the following configuration values before restarting the service.

service settings:
novath:
  pin: 1396
  tenant: pelys
  seal: seal_ccc035e1
  metrics_host: metrics.novath.qorvelworks.test
  standby_team: fraeth
  escalation: drueth-zorok
  nonce: 61d508